Honey Cinnamon Glazed Boneless Pork Chops

3  1 inch boneless Pork Chops
3 Tbsp of Honey
1 tsp of Cinnamon
1 Tbsp brown sugar (optional)
Salt
Pepper

Brine Pork Chops for at least 30 minutes prior to baking to make them juicy.

Preheat oven to 350. 

Add olive oil to a pan on medium heat.  Put salt and pepper on the chops and brown the sides in the pan. Turning only once.

To prepare the glaze, add honey, cinnamon, and brown sugar to a microwave safe dish.  Heat on High for 20 seconds.  Stir to blend.

In a baking dish add the brown chops and top with honey glaze.  Bake  uncovered for15 minutes. Then turn them over and top the other side with the honey glaze.  Cook another 15 to 20 minutes until done or 160 degrees internally.
